What is Web Development?
Web development is the process of creating and maintaining websites. It involves designing web pages, writing code, and managing website functionality. Developers use different programming languages and tools to build websites that are fast, responsive, and user-friendly.
Web development is generally divided into three main categories:
- Frontend Development
- Backend Development
- Full Stack Development
Frontend Development
Frontend development focuses on the visual part of a website that users can see and interact with. Frontend developers create layouts, buttons, menus, and animations.
Important Frontend Technologies
- HTML – Used to create webpage structure
- CSS – Used for styling and design
- JavaScript – Adds interactivity and dynamic features
Frontend developers also use frameworks like React and Bootstrap to make development faster and more efficient.
Backend Development
Backend development handles the server-side operations of a website. It manages databases, authentication, and website logic.
Popular Backend Languages
- Python
- PHP
- JavaScript (Node.js)
- Java
Backend developers work with databases such as MySQL and MongoDB to store and manage website data.
Full Stack Development
A full stack developer can handle both frontend and backend development. They have knowledge of complete website creation from design to server management.
Full stack development is a great option for beginners who want to become versatile developers.
Essential Skills for Beginners
To become a successful web developer, beginners should focus on learning these skills:
1. HTML and CSS
Start with HTML and CSS because they are the foundation of web development.
2. JavaScript
JavaScript helps create interactive websites and is one of the most important programming languages.
3. Responsive Design
Learn how to make websites mobile-friendly using responsive design techniques.
4. Version Control
Git and GitHub help developers manage code and collaborate with others.
5. Problem Solving
Strong logical thinking and problem-solving skills are essential for coding.
